Arthur Greenwood Obituary

Arthur Craig Greenwood

AGE: 55 • Millsboro

Arthur Craig Greenwood, 55 of Millsboro, DE, passed away suddenly August 23, 2014. Born in France to American parents stationed there in the US Army. Craig was the son of Woodrow Arthur Greenwood and Babette Ritter Greenwood. He attended Indian River High School in DE and graduated High School in Salisbury, MD. He worked in construction and was schooled in Baltimore, MD in Concrete Finishing and Color Stone Paving. The beautiful entrances to many hotels and casinos in DE were done by Craig. He enjoyed fishing, hunting, and all sports. He was the beloved father of Nicole B. Greenwood, Jami N. Greenwood and granddaughter Tahli Greenwood. He is also survived by his father, Arthur, his mother, Babette, a brother Brent Greenwood, a brother Jay Greenwood and his family (wife Joy and daughters, Molly, Lainey, Lily). He is also survived by his 97 year old grandfather, Robert J. Ritter. He was preceded in death by his much loved grandparents Woodrow and Irene Greenwood and Winifred Ritter. He was also preceded in death by his loved uncles Joel Ritter and Ronald Greenwood. Craig was a US Army veteran and interment was held in the Delaware Veterans Memorial Cemetery.
